How to Connect Invoiced to Cursor via MCP
Follow these steps to integrate the Invoiced MCP Server with Cursor.
Open MCP Settings
Press Cmd+Shift+P (macOS) or Ctrl+Shift+P (Windows/Linux) → search "MCP Settings"
Add the server config
Paste the JSON configuration above into the mcp.json file that opens
Save the file
Cursor will automatically detect the new MCP server
Start using Invoiced
Open Agent mode in chat and ask: "Using Invoiced, help me...". 10 tools available

Invoiced MCP Tools for Cursor (10)
These 10 tools become available when you connect Invoiced to Cursor via MCP:
get_customer
Returns contact info, balance data, and payment settings. Use for deep intelligence on a customer before billing interactions. Retrieves details for a specific customer
get_invoice
Essential for auditing specific billings or providing customer support. Retrieves details for a specific invoice
list_coupons
Useful for auditing marketing incentives. Lists all active discount coupons
list_customers
Returns customer names, account numbers, and IDs. Use this as the main starting point for managing receivables or identifying specific clients. Lists all customers in Invoiced
list_invoices
Includes invoice numbers, amounts, and statuses. Essential for monitoring accounts receivable and overall revenue flow. Lists all invoices
list_items
Includes item codes, descriptions, and unit prices. Useful for auditing the available billing inventory. Lists all items in your catalog
list_payments
Returns payment methods, amounts, and transaction IDs. Use this to audit revenue collection and reconcile bank statements. Lists all payments received
list_plans

list_subscriptions
Essential for monitoring long-term customer commitments and MRR (Monthly Recurring Revenue). Lists all active customer subscriptions
list_tax_rates
Essential for auditing compliance and understanding how taxes are applied to invoices. Lists all defined tax rates
